AS705 is a dormant, unrouted autonomous system number inside ARIN's legacy UUNET block (AS701-AS705), registered to Verizon Business via MCI Communications Services LLC. It announces zero IPv4 and zero IPv6 prefixes today and does not appear in the global routing table, making it an inactive placeholder within an otherwise live Tier-1 backbone block.

ARIN does not maintain a separate RDAP object for AS705 alone; querying autnum 705 returns the combined AS701-AS705 range, RIR object name UUNET, registrant handle MCICS. That block's top-level registration event dates to 1990-08-03, with a last-changed event on 2022-05-31 — both are first-party ARIN RDAP facts, not IEEE or third-party scrape artifacts.

The block traces to UUNET, one of the first commercial U.S. ISPs (founded 1987) and an original Tier-1 backbone operator. UUNET's assets passed through MFS/WorldCom (1996) and MCI, then to Verizon after its 2006 MCI acquisition, forming Verizon Business. Within the block, AS701 (US), AS702 (Europe), and AS703 (ASPAC) are the actively peered, PeeringDB-listed regional networks; AS705 shows no such presence and appears to be an unused number reserved inside the range rather than a distinct advertised network.

The one notable historical event tied to this pair is the August 12, 2014 route leak: AS701 and AS705 leaked roughly 22,000 more-specific /24 prefixes, helping push the global IPv4 routing table past the 512k-route ceiling and crashing older Cisco 6500 hardware, with Shaw Canada reporting nationwide routing failures. RFC 7908 cites the incident as a Type 4 accidental-deaggregation route leak, and NANOG archives characterize it as transient and unintentional rather than malicious.

Routing/peering
no upstreams, no peers, no customer cone observed. CAIDA ASRank has no measured ranking for AS705: its record returns seen=false and cliqueMember=false, an AS-degree of 0 total / 0 customer / 0 peer / 0 provider, and a cone of 1 ASN / 0 prefixes / 0 addresses. The rank value it carries, 79459, is the shared bottom-rank sentinel CAIDA assigns to every ASN it has never observed in the topology graph — not a position — so as_rank is recorded null here rather than 79459
[Confirmed] — https://bgp.tools/as/705, https://api.asrank.caida.org/v2/restful/asns/705 (queried 2026-07-28)
